Proposition 1 Ballot Language
Source for below: KMVT article | Sen. Tammy Nichols’ article
Revised ballot statements approved by Idaho Supreme Court — September 4, 2026:
YES: A YES vote would support creating a right to abortion before fetal viability—defined as a fetus’ ability to survive without extraordinary medical measures—and after fetal viability in cases of medical emergency; providing protections against professional discipline and civil and criminal liability for healthcare providers; and codifying a statutory reproductive right to freedom and privacy.
NO: A NO vote would support making no change to Idaho’s current law, which preserves the life of preborn children by prohibiting abortion, except when necessary to prevent the death of the pregnant woman, and during the first trimester in documented cases of rape or incest reported to law enforcement.

Current Idaho Law
Current Idaho abortion laws (near-total ban):
Full Title 18, Chapter 6: Idaho Legislature. Laws current as of 2025.
Idaho Code § 18-622 (Defense of Life Act / Trigger Ban): Criminalizes abortion (felony, 2-5 years prison for providers). Exceptions: life of mother; rape/incest (first trimester only, with police report). Statute | Bill: S1385 (2020).
Idaho Code §§ 18-8804 to 18-8807 (6-week ban / heartbeat law): Bans abortion after ~6 weeks via private civil lawsuits. Statute | Bill: S1309 (2022).
Abortion Trafficking (H242, 2023): Criminalizes transporting/recruiting minors for abortion without parental consent (2-5 years). Statute | Bill: H0242.
